Community Pool Rules & Details

RULES FOR USE OF THE POOL

Keys:
Each residence is allocated one key which may be obtained by a deposit and an ID. BR IV residents must also show a current copy of their transaction history showing a zero balance within 48 hours of key request. Keys are available at the William Douglas Office located at: 4523 Park Road, Suite 201A.

  • Loaning keys is not permitted.

  • Keep the gate closed and locked at all times.

Hours:

  • Pool hours are 7 a.m. to dark.

  • Swim at your own risk. There is NO LIFEGUARD on duty.

Use of the Pool:

  • Shower before entering the pool.

  • Wear suitable bathing attire.

  • Anyone with skin abrasions, open wounds, coughs, colds, inflamed eyes, infections, or any other contagious condition is not allowed in the pool area.

  • Children under 13 must be supervised by an adult at all times; the adult is responsible for the child’s safety and behavior.
    Any guests must be accompanied by the BR/BR VI resident at all times.

  • Audio devices must be used with headsets.

  • Children who are not toilet trained must wear swim diapers when in the pool.

  • All diapers must be taken home. Do not dispose in pool deck or bathroom trash containers.

  • Dispose of all other trash in containers provided on pool deck and bathroom.

  • Safety equipment is for emergency use only; the health department requires that all safety equipment be in excellent condition and at the proper location at all times.

  • Close umbrellas and return pool furniture to its original location when leaving pool.

The following is prohibited:

  • Diving

  • Illegal substances

  • Alcohol - except at adults-only Association sponsored events.

  • Smoking

  • Running

  • Pets

  • Bicycles, skateboards, rollerblades, roller skates, or any similar items

  • Air mattresses or other flotation devices

  • Pool furniture in the pool

  • Glass containers (health department regulation - if broken glass is found, the pool will be closed, drained, and refilled at the Association’s expense).

  • Unruly behavior, horseplay, spitting, or ball playing.

  • Rocks, debris, trash, cigarettes, or ashes of any kind.

In the case of an EMERGENCY:

  • The emergency phone is for 911 only. The street address and phone number are listed on the inside of the call box for location identification.

  • Report any other vandalism or other issues to William Douglas: games@wmdouglas.com.

  • All residents agree to release and indemnify the Association from any claims, losses, or liability.

  • Enjoy the pool and help keep it safe for everyone. Failure to observe rules may result in the loss of pool privileges. The Board reserves the right to deny use of the pool at any time.
